Il comando di creazione del profilo smo
È possibile eseguire il comando di creazione del profilo per creare un profilo di un database in un repository. È necessario montare il database prima di eseguire questo comando.
Sintassi
smo profile create -profile profile \[-profile-password profile_password\] -repository -dbname repo_service_name -host repo_host -port repo_port -login -username repo_username -database -dbname db_dbname -host db_host [-sid db_sid\] [-login \[-username db_username -password db_password -port db_port\] ] [-rman \{-controlfile \| \{-login -username rman_username -password rman_password\} -tnsname rman_tnsname\}\}] [-retain \[-hourly \[-count n\] \[-duration m\]\] \[-daily \[-count n\] \[-duration m\]] \[-weekly \[-count n\] \[-duration m\]] \[-monthly \[-count n\] \[-duration m\]]]] -comment comment -snapname-pattern pattern [] [-summary-notification] [-notification \[-success -email email_address1,email_address2 -subject subject_pattern\] \[-failure -email email_address1,email_address2 -subject subject_pattern] [-separate-archivelog-backups -retain-archivelog-backups -hours hours | -days days | -weeks weeks | -months months [] [-include-with-online-backups \| -no-include-with-online-backups]] [-dump] [-quiet | -verbose]
Parametri
-
-profilo profilo
Specifica il nome del profilo. Questo nome può contenere fino a 30 caratteri e deve essere univoco all'interno dell'host.
-
-profile-password profile_password
Specificare la password per il profilo.
-
-repository
Le opzioni che seguono -repository specificano i dettagli del database che memorizza il profilo.
-
-dbname repo_service_name
Specifica il nome del database in cui è memorizzato il profilo. Utilizzare il nome globale o il SID.
-
-host repo_host
Specifica il nome o l'indirizzo IP del computer host su cui viene eseguito il database del repository.
-
-sid db_sid
Specifica l'identificativo di sistema del database descritto dal profilo. Per impostazione predefinita, SnapManager utilizza il nome del database come identificatore di sistema. Se l'identificatore di sistema è diverso dal nome del database, è necessario specificarlo con l'opzione -sid.
-
-login
Specifica i dettagli di accesso al repository.
-
-nome utente repo_nome utente
Specifica il nome utente necessario per accedere al database del repository.
-
-port repo_port
Specifica il numero di porta TCP utilizzato per accedere al database del repository.
-
-database
Specifica i dettagli del database descritti dal profilo. Si tratta del database di cui verrà eseguito il backup, il ripristino o il cloning.
-
-dbname db_dbname
Specifica il nome del database descritto dal profilo. È possibile utilizzare il nome globale o l'identificatore di sistema.
-
-host db_host db_host
Specifica il nome o l'indirizzo IP del computer host su cui viene eseguito il database.
-
-login
Specifica i dettagli di accesso al database.
-
-nome utente db_nome utente
Specifica il nome utente necessario per accedere al database descritto dal profilo.
-
-password db_password
Specifica la password necessaria per accedere al database descritto dal profilo.
-
-port db_port
Specifica il numero di porta TCP utilizzato per accedere al database descritto dal profilo.
-
-rman
Specifica i dettagli utilizzati da SnapManager per catalogare i backup con Oracle Recovery Manager (RMAN).
-
-controlfile
Specifica i file di controllo del database di destinazione invece di un catalogo come repository RMAN.
-
-login
Specifica i dettagli di accesso RMAN.
-
-password rman_password
Specifica la password utilizzata per accedere al catalogo RMAN.
-
-username rman_username
Specifica il nome utente utilizzato per accedere al catalogo RMAN.
-
-tnsname tnsname
Specifica il nome di connessione tnsname (definito nel file tsname.ora).
-
-retain [-hourly [-count n] [-duration m]] [-giornaliero [-count n] [-duration m]] [-settimanale [-count n] [-duration m]] [-mensile [-count n] [-duration m]]
Specifica il criterio di conservazione per un backup in cui uno o entrambi i conteggi di conservazione insieme alla durata di conservazione per una classe di conservazione (oraria, giornaliera, settimanale, mensile).
Per ciascuna classe di conservazione, è possibile specificare uno o entrambi i valori di un conteggio o di una durata di conservazione. La durata è espressa in unità della classe (ad esempio, ore per ora, giorni per giorno). Ad esempio, se l'utente specifica solo una durata di conservazione di 7 per i backup giornalieri, SnapManager non limiterà il numero di backup giornalieri per il profilo (poiché il numero di conservazione è 0), ma SnapManager eliminerà automaticamente i backup giornalieri creati oltre 7 giorni fa.
-
-commento commento
Specifica il commento per un profilo che descrive il dominio del profilo.
-
-snapname-pattern pattern
Specifica il modello di denominazione per le copie Snapshot. È inoltre possibile includere testo personalizzato, ad esempio HAOPS per operazioni altamente disponibili, in tutti i nomi delle copie Snapshot. È possibile modificare il modello di denominazione della copia Snapshot quando si crea un profilo o dopo averlo creato. Il modello aggiornato si applica solo alle copie Snapshot non ancora create. Le copie Snapshot esistenti conservano il modello Snapname precedente. È possibile utilizzare diverse variabili nel testo del modello.
-
-summary-notification
Specifica che la notifica email di riepilogo è attivata per il nuovo profilo.
-
-notification -success-email email email_address1,email address2 -subject subject_pattern
Specifica che la notifica e-mail è attivata per il nuovo profilo in modo che i destinatari ricevano i messaggi e-mail quando l'operazione SnapManager ha esito positivo. È necessario immettere un singolo indirizzo e-mail o più indirizzi e-mail a cui inviare gli avvisi e-mail e un modello di oggetto e-mail per il nuovo profilo.
È inoltre possibile includere il testo dell'oggetto personalizzato per il nuovo profilo. È possibile modificare il testo dell'oggetto quando si crea un profilo o dopo averlo creato. L'oggetto aggiornato si applica solo ai messaggi e-mail non inviati. È possibile utilizzare diverse variabili per l'oggetto dell'e-mail.
-
-notification -failure -email email_address1,email address2 -subject subject_pattern
Specifica che l'opzione attiva notifica e-mail è attivata per il nuovo profilo in modo che i destinatari ricevano i messaggi e-mail quando l'operazione SnapManager non riesce. È necessario immettere un singolo indirizzo e-mail o più indirizzi e-mail a cui inviare gli avvisi e-mail e un modello di oggetto e-mail per il nuovo profilo.
È inoltre possibile includere il testo dell'oggetto personalizzato per il nuovo profilo. È possibile modificare il testo dell'oggetto quando si crea un profilo o dopo averlo creato. L'oggetto aggiornato si applica solo ai messaggi e-mail non inviati. È possibile utilizzare diverse variabili per l'oggetto dell'e-mail.
-
-storage-backup-separati
Specifica che il backup del registro di archiviazione è separato dal backup dei file di dati. Si tratta di un parametro facoltativo che è possibile fornire durante la creazione del profilo. Dopo aver separato il backup utilizzando questa opzione, è possibile eseguire il backup solo dei file di dati o il backup solo dei registri di archiviazione.
-
-retain-archiveog-backups -ore | -daysdays | -weeksweeks| -monthsmonths
Specifica che i backup del registro di archiviazione vengono conservati in base alla durata di conservazione del registro di archiviazione (oraria, giornaliera, settimanale, mensile).
-
-quiet
Visualizza solo i messaggi di errore nella console. L'impostazione predefinita prevede la visualizzazione dei messaggi di errore e di avviso.
-
-dettagliato
Visualizza messaggi di errore, di avviso e informativi nella console.
-
-include-with-online-backups
Specifica che il backup del registro di archiviazione è incluso insieme al backup del database online.
-
-no-include-with-online-backups
Specifica che i backup del registro di archiviazione non sono inclusi insieme al backup del database online.
-
-dump
Specifica che i file dump vengono raccolti dopo l'operazione di creazione del profilo.
Esempio
Nell'esempio seguente viene illustrata la creazione di un profilo con policy di conservazione oraria e notifica via email:
smo profile create -profile test_rbac -profile-password netapp -repository -dbname SMOREP -host hostname.org.com -port 1521 -login -username smorep -database -dbname RACB -host saal -sid racb1 -login -username sys -password netapp -port 1521 -rman -controlfile -retain -hourly -count 30 -verbose Operation Id [8abc01ec0e78ebda010e78ebe6a40005] succeeded.
Informazioni correlate